Output 3430a2db1565daae326e57149c2a95c9d763fcf9d176785ac64af69eea40403e:0

value
1795000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db944c05549531ba6c59b6880804967fb3518754 OP_EQUAL
address
3Mi3ZQc2YNuAmHZ7VKzDHStryAEdDQkyp8
transaction
3430a2db1565daae326e57149c2a95c9d763fcf9d176785ac64af69eea40403e
spent
true